At the core of BrickPlatter’s investment model lies the concept of the ‘Brick’- a proprietary unit that represents a fractional share in a property. Much like equity shares in a company, each Brick offers proportional ownership in a real estate asset through a Special Purpose Vehicle (SPV), entitling the investor to rental earnings and capital gains. This innovative structure not only ensures transparency and legal compliance but also simplifies the management and distribution of returns. With comprehensive due diligence and SPV-backed governance, investors can engage in real estate investments with the confidence traditionally associated with institutional-grade assets.

Moreover, the platform is built with liquidity in mind. Recognizing that one of the key pain points of real estate investment has been the long and complicated exit cycles, BrickPlatter offers easy resale / exit options through its secondary marketplace. Investors can resell their Bricks to other buyers on the platform, creating a dynamic, tradable ecosystem for real estate ownership.

Kończą się konsultacje Planu Społeczno-Klimatycznego. 2,4 mld euro trafi na sektor transportu po 2026 roku

Dobiegają końca konsultacje społeczne Planu Społeczno-Klimatycznego, tzw. KPO2, który ma być podstawą do wypłaty środków z nowego instrumentu finansowego Unii Europejskiej – Społecznego Funduszu Klimatycznego. Ministerstwo Funduszy i Polityki Regionalnej zapowiada, że mają one trafić m.in. na walkę z tzw. ubóstwem transportowym, łagodzenie skutków wprowadzenia ETS2 i unowocześnienie kolei, które stanowi ogromne wyzwanie.

Polski e-commerce rośnie w siłę. Konsumentów przyciągają przede wszystkim promocje

Rynek e-commerce w Polsce jest już wart ok. 152 mld zł. Rośnie zarówno częstotliwość zakupów, jak i średnia wartość koszyka – wynika z raportu Strategy&. Polacy doceniają wygodę zakupów przez internet, szybką dostawę i łatwy zwrot. Coraz częściej zwracają też uwagę na cenę i chętnie korzystają z promocji. To właśnie ten trend wykorzystuje Amazon.pl, organizując co roku festiwal z okazji Prime Day. W tym roku zaplanowano go po raz pierwszy aż na cztery dni: 8–11 lipca, a nie dwa jak w poprzednich latach.
